Ordinals
beta
Sat 731985902306065
decimal
146397.902306065
degree
0°146397′1245″902306065‴
percentile
34.856471576726186%
name
iqxxmcpezwy
cycle
0
epoch
0
period
72
block
146397
offset
902306065
timestamp
2011-09-22 06:25:38 UTC
rarity
common
prev
next